Livin' the Low Life – Season 2 from January 20

Livin’ the Low Life begins its second season on Jan 20 at 8.pm. It’s all set to start with a look at the cultural phenomenon of the lowriders. Lowriders are cars customized to run as low to the ground as possible. On the West coast, the low rider clubs are like families, and members spend heavily on their rides.

In the last season, the show focused on different styles of the cars. In the second season, the focus will be the people and their lifestyle. The channel looks at tapping the community which is much bigger than what they thought it would be.

The show will be hosted by the low rider girl, Vida Guerra. Guerra is best known as a model, often appearing in lingerie - or less - and being on virtually every "hottest babe" list imaginable. Growing up in Perth Amboy, N.J., this model and actress knew little about the lowrider car clubs of Los Angeles. But as the host of the show, she wishes that the show will help her propel her Hollywood career.

Active Food Scenes of Detroit

Detroit is all about action- the automobile industry, the musical concerts, the nightlife, and the sports. People are always on the move here. That’s what makes the city so fascinating, not just for the locals but for tourists as well. Casino resorts are also a big pull for visitors. The city is completely equipped to keep people satisfied in every way. Gastronomical pleasures are no exception.

Restaurants in Detroit are top class, eclectic and buzzing with life. Here are few suggestions of the best in town:

If you’re a seeking for pizzas, you’ll have to head towards Greektown for a visit to Pizzapapalis. Their pizzas are rated pretty high. For simply American cuisine, Coach Insignia is your answer. You’re bound to relish your food even better atop the Renaissance Center. Stop by at the Mexican Town Restaurant Detroit, to get a taste of their margaritas. You’ll see why it’s one of the top three restaurants here.

There’s plenty of barbecue, Italian and seafood as well. Absolutely no dearth of anything you seek in this musical place also called as Motown.
